Subject: [PATCH 09/10] ACPI: remove acpi_device_uid() and related stuff
Date: Mon, 24 Aug 2009 10:39:16 -0600 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090824163916.28131.28482.stgit@bob.kio>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20090824163659.28131.96400.stgit@bob.kio>
Nobody uses acpi_device_uid(), so this patch removes it.
Signed-off-by: Bjorn Helgaas <bjorn.helgaas@hp.com>
---
drivers/acpi/scan.c | 12 ------------
include/acpi/acpi_bus.h | 6 +-----
2 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 17 deletions(-)
